Dave Schultz has been public speaking for more than 25 years. Having been a member of two Stanley Cup Championship teams, ACHL League Commissioner, General Manager and Head Coach in both the ECHL and UHL, an entrepreneur, father, and commentator, Dave loves to share his unique perspective on life, sports and team relations. Schultz, accredited for earning the Flyers the nickname “The Broad Street Bullies”, was more than just a fighting force on the ice and has proven to be much more in his post career. Schultz’ speeches have gained him respect and prove to be an inspiration to organizations, public and private.
Career Highlights:
- As a rookie in 1972-73, led the league with 259 penalty minutes
- Played a key role in helping the Flyers win Stanley Cup Championships in 1974 and 1975.
- Played for the Los Angeles Kings, the Pittsburgh Penguins and the Buffalo Sabres before ending his playing career in 1980.
- His NHL totals included 79 goals, 200 points and 2,294 penalty minutes in 535 regular season games
- Coached professional hockey in the United Hockey League and East Coast Hockey League for three seasons before moving back to the Philadelphia area.

Dave Schultz, now the President of the Philadelphia Flyers Alumni Association, keeps active in playing charity hockey games and organizing charity events such as the annual golf classic, dinner and Roast. Schultz is a strong force to be reckoned with and brings his spirit to any playing field. |
